| claudication |
Pain in the muscles (especially the calf muscles) during exercise caused by too little blood flow.

| clamp connection |
in Basidiomycota, a hyphal outgrowth which, at cell division, makes a connection between the resulting two cells by fusing with the lower and acting as a passage for nuclear transfer.
